Free Things to Do in Coeur d'Alene

Traveling to Coeur d'Alene on a budget? The following can be experienced for nada.

University Of Idaho Coeur d'Alene - If you're an admirer of modern-day design and architecture, add this landmark to your list of must-sees.

North Idaho College - Roam around this historic place and learn a couple of secrets from yesteryear.

Lake Coeur d'Alene - Just being near the water is certain to leave you feeling refreshed and rejuvenated.

Sanders Beach - Bounce rocks across the water, watch the sun come up or just take in the views from the shore.

Tubbs Hill - Unwind and let the natural surroundings ease your soul.

McEuen Park - Grab your picnic blanket, pack some food and find a comfortable spot to be with nature.
